You’ve got a new acoustic guitar and are learning the elementals,eg the parts of the guitar.  The very next thing which will come to your mind is the simple way to play guitar tabs.

Learning to play guitar tabs is an extremely important part of guitar lessons, and serves as a base for advancing in the ability.  It’s all about understanding the right placement positions of the fingers on the fretboard.  If you need to be taught how to play guitar tabs, you will have to know how to read the notations on the guitar tablature sheet and place the specific fingers on the fretboard. 

Basics of Guitar Strings

On a standard acoustic or electrical guitar, there are six strings.  Many have a misconception about the counting of the strings.  They consider the thickest one the first string, just because it is on the top ; and the thinnest one the last, as it is at the bottom.  {However ,} the fact is the thinnest string is the first one and the thickest one is the last.  All these individual strings have a certain open sound.  The 1st string has a high  ‘e’ sound, the second has a  ‘B’ sound, the third one has a  ‘G’ sound, the 4th has a  ‘D’ sound, the 5th has an  ‘A’ sound, and the last string has the lowest  ‘E’ sound.  You will be able to more clearly comprehend if you refer to the figure given below. 

E ( first ) —————————-

B ( second ) —————————

G ( 3rd ) —————————

D ( 4th ) —————————

A ( fifth ) —————————

E ( 6th ) —————————

Holding Notations on Guitar Fretboard

Now you have got an idea of the open sounds of all six strings, you can learn the way to play guitar tabs.  A guitar tab is a diagram of six horizontal lines that designate the six strings.  And on these 6 lines, there are certain numbers.  These numbers show on which fret you are supposed to place the fingertips.  If there is a  ’0′ shown on the string, it implies you will need to play the string open without pressing any point on that particular string.  If there is an  ‘X’ shown on any string, it means you do not have to play that particular string at all or have to mute it with your strumming hand.
